推荐这个菜鸟教程学习htmlHTML 编辑器 | 菜鸟教程
html简介
第一行先写个声明 有助于浏览器正确显示网页<!DOCTYPE html>
<head>里面放<meta charset="utf-8"> 网页编码格式。还有<title>
<body>里面放网页内容
整体由<html>标签包裹
html编辑器
vscode
VS Code 可以安装 Live Preview 插件来实时预览编写的代码:
html基础
标题:<h1>-<h6>
段落:<p>
链接: <a href="https://www.runoob.com">这是一个链接</a>
图像:<img src="/images/logo.png" width="258" height="39" />图像的名称和尺寸是以属性的形式提供的
html元素
<br>换行
html属性
属性总是以 name="value" 的形式写在标签内,name 是属性的名称,value 是属性的值。
HTML 链接由 <a> 标签定义。链接的地址在 href 属性中指定
属性值应该始终被包括在引号内。
双引号是最常用的,不过使用单引号也没有问题。
在某些个别的情况下,比如属性值本身就含有双引号,那么您必须使用单引号
html标题
水平线 <hr>
注释:<!-- 这是一个注释 -->
html输出
对于 HTML,您无法通过在 HTML 代码中添加额外的空格或换行来改变输出的效果。
当显示页面时,浏览器会移除源代码中多余的空格和空行。所有连续的空格或空行都会被算作一个空格。需要注意的是,HTML 代码中的所有连续的空行(换行)也被显示为一个空格。
html格式化标签
<b>这个文本是加粗的</b>
<strong>这个文本是加粗的</strong>
<big>这个文本字体放大</big>
<em>这个文本是斜体的</em>
<i>这个文本是斜体的</i>
<small>这个文本是缩小的</small>
这个文本包含
<sub>下标</sub>
这个文本包含
<sup>上标</sup>
预格式文本:输出和你写的一样的格式
<pre>
此例演示如何使用 pre 标签
对空行和 空格
进行控制
</pre>
写地址
<address>
Written by <a href="mailto:webmaster@example.com">Jon Doe</a>.<br>
Visit us at:<br>
Example.com<br>
Box 564, Disneyland<br>
USA
</address>
改变文字方向 <p><bdo dir="rtl">该段落文字从右到左显示。</bdo></p>
<blockquote>标签,将大段文字作为独立的块。<q>定义短的引用“”
删除字效果和插入文本:
<p>My favorite color is <del>blue</del> <ins>red</ins>!</p>